I did not take part in an Asian Club (there never was one in my school) but I was head for the Multicultural Club. You can also watch Asian dramas (not only anime). Some good ones are: My Name Is Kim Sam Soon, My Girl, and many others. mysoju.com is a really good source for Asian movies and dramas. Also, look up different Asian holidays or festivals. Then on that day, dress up in the traditional dress of that Asian culture, and do whatever they do on that day. For example, Japan had cherry blossom festivals where the girls wear summer kimonos and walk along parks that have cherry blossom trees in full bloom. New Years is a really good one (Chinese New Years, that is). There are many possibilities. Also, as a group, you can all pick one Asian language you all want to learn, and then practice it together. It’s even better if a few of you can already speak it to teach the others. It’s a fun way to bond.
You can set up a day where everyone dresses in Asian cultural clothing and brings cultural foods to eat and watch an Asian movie set in the years of samurais, ninjas, Emperors, etc.
In order to keep the group going, you need to find younger students who really enjoy the club. Ask them if they’d be interested in being head next year and advise them on how to do so. Tell them how to get younger people to keep it going when they leave.
